Suomen Mestari 1: A Top Foundation for Learning Finnish
Suomen Mestari 1 is widely regarded as one of the most effective Finnish language textbooks for beginners. Published by Finn Lectura, it is designed for adult learners who aim to reach the A1 level of the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R). Its clear structure, practical vocabulary, and emphasis on everyday communication make it a top choice for self-study and classroom use alike.
The book is divided into thematic chapters, each introducing essential grammar points (such as verb types, local cases, and basic sentence structures) alongside real-life topics: introducing oneself, telling time, shopping, housing, and daily routines. Unlike older textbooks, Suomen Mestari 1 relies almost entirely on Finnish from the start, immersing the learner in the language without translation. This approach forces active thinking and pattern recognition, which accelerates acquisition.
What makes it a “top” resource is its balance between rigor and accessibility. Each chapter includes listening exercises, reading passages, written tasks, and pair-work prompts. The audio materials (available separately or via the publisher’s digital platform) feature natural-paced Finnish spoken by multiple voices — crucial for mastering the rhythm and intonation of a language as phonetically consistent yet unfamiliar as Finnish.
For independent learners, the main challenge is the lack of answer keys and English instructions in the standard edition. However, the Suomen Mestari series offers a separate teacher’s guide and online exercises. Legally accessing the PDF version usually requires purchase through the Finn Lectura shop or an institutional license. Some public libraries in Finland also provide digital loans.
In conclusion, Suomen Mestari 1 earns its reputation as a top Finnish textbook due to its communicative focus, structured progression, and authentic materials. While obtaining a free PDF would be copyright infringement, investing in the legal book or digital edition supports the authors and grants access to supplementary online content — a fair exchange for such a high-quality learning tool. What Is Suomen mestari 1?
Suomen mestari 1 is the first book in a popular four-part series (levels A1–B2). It covers:
- Basic vocabulary (family, food, weather, home)
- Key grammar (verb types, partitive case, consonant gradation, basic sentence structures)
- Everyday dialogues (shopping, asking for directions, making appointments)
The book is entirely in Finnish — no English translations — which immerses you from day one. Many learners love this, but some find it challenging without extra support.

Uusi Kielemme: This website is a massive Finnish grammar database that explains the specific topics (like Partitiivi or Verbityypit) found in the first book in much more detail. 4. Comparison: Old vs. New Edition
When looking for a PDF or guide, check which version you are getting:
Original (Blue Cover): The classic version used for over a decade.
Uudistettu (Renewed - Multi-color/Modern Cover): Updated in 2020-2022 with more modern vocabulary and diverse cultural references. Most courses now use this version.

Online Complements: Many learners pair the book with WordDive or Quizlet sets specifically designed to track the chapters in Suomen mestari 1. Tips for Success
Don't skip the audio: Finnish is phonetic, but the "long" and "short" sounds (tuli vs. tuuli) are hard to distinguish without listening.
Focus on Verb Types: Master the five verb types introduced in the first book; they are the "engine" of the Finnish language.
Use the Glossary: Most versions come with a Finnish-English-Russian-Arabic glossary, which is an invaluable shortcut.

Pedagogical Approach: The Communicative Method
The primary strength of Suomen mestari 1 lies in its adoption of the communicative language teaching method. Unlike older, grammar-translation textbooks which rely on rote memorization of tables and rules, Suomen mestari 1 prioritizes practical usage.
- Inductive Grammar Learning: Instead of presenting massive grammar charts upfront, the book introduces grammar structures through dialogues and texts. Students are encouraged to deduce the rules from context before the formal explanation is presented at the end of the chapter. This mirrors natural language acquisition.
- Immediate Utility: The vocabulary is curated for immediate relevance. Early chapters focus on introductions, shopping, family, and navigating the city—scenarios a new immigrant or student in Finland would encounter on day one.
- Target Language Immersion: The book is written almost entirely in Finnish. While this may seem daunting to a beginner, it forces the learner to rely on visual context, cognates, and deduction rather than translating everything in their head.
